PMUC joins effort with SRT and RU Lampang to launch 2nd round of train tourism, taking tourists on a winter trip to see meteor shower at Mae Moh.

On December 13th– 15th, 2022, Lampang Rajabhat University together with the State Railway of Thailand (SRT) organized a pilot trip package with a special train route, signing an MOU on services and research under the project to develop creative tourism by train thru the Lanna era route. There is also a food culture tourism element under the creative tourism project based on Lampang’s unique cuisine and surrounding areas around Lampang Rajabhat University. The fund to suppor the research project was granted by the Program Management Unit for Competitiveness (PMUC) under the Science, Research and Innovation Fund, with an aim to exchange knowledge on the development of railway tourism routes and the old town of Lampang, Lamphun, and Chiang Mai.

This trip is the 2nd time for the tour, with the first trip happening last November on the route of the Lanna era thru old town, Lampang, Lamphun, and Chiang Mai, which received an overwhelming response, leading to this second tour with new special features added on. The trip allows tourists to experience the local way of life in the Lanna culture, especially the trip to see the Geminids meteor shower, which is one of the most prominent meteor showers of the year at the stargazing ground of the Electricity Generating Authority of Mae Moh, Chiang Mai Province. Tourists will also have a chance to pay respect to important sacred places of Lampang and Lamphun provinces, such as Wat Phra That Lampang Luang, Wat Phra Kaew Don Tao, Suchadaram Trilak Cemetery, Wat Doi Phra Chan, Wat Phra That Hariphunchai Woramahawihan. Tourists will also get to go shopping for local products like ceramics and handicrafts at Long Him Cow etc.

Organizing a trip on this special train route has been well received by tourists, who were very impressed. But furthermore, this extraordinary route would never have been possible if not for the research process through learning the way of life, culture and identity of each locality. The next travel route will be organized at the beginning of next year to welcome the new year in 2023 under the theme of “Make Merit, Enhance Charisma at 9 Temples of Good Luck to Welcome the New Year” by traveling with a special procession of Utravithi between 20-22 January 2023
